How to Make New Friends with Group Travel
Group travel with PKT can be an exciting and enriching experience, especially when it comes to making new friends. If want to expand your social circle, here are some tips for making new friends during group travel.

Start with introductions
One of the simplest and most effective ways to make new
friends during group travel is to introduce yourself to other members of the
group. Make a point to talk to everyone, even if you don't think you have much
in common. You never know who might become a great travel buddy or lifelong
friend.
Be open-minded
When you're traveling with a group, you'll encounter people
from all walks of life, each with their own unique experiences and
perspectives. Be open-minded and willing to learn from others, even if they
have different interests or beliefs. You'll have a much richer travel
experience and may even discover new hobbies or passions.
Participate in group activities
Most group tours or trips will have a variety of activities
planned, from sightseeing to adventure sports to cultural events. Make an
effort to participate in as many of these activities as possible. This will
give you the chance to bond with other members of the group over shared
experiences and interests.
Ask questions
Asking questions is a great way to get to know other members
of the group and show that you're interested in their experiences. Ask about
their favorite travel destinations, hobbies, or even what they do for a living.
This will help you find common ground and create meaningful connections.
Share your experiences
Sharing your own travel experiences is another way to
connect with other members of the group. Talk about your favorite travel
destinations, memorable experiences, or even travel mishaps. You might even
inspire others to add new destinations to their bucket lists.
Use social media
Social media can be a great tool for staying in touch with
new friends you meet during group travel. Exchange social media handles or
create a group chat to share photos, travel tips, and keep in touch after the
trip is over.
Making new friends during group travel is a great way to enhance your
travel experience and create meaningful connections. By starting with
introductions, being open-minded, participating in group activities, asking
questions, sharing your experiences, and using social media, you'll have plenty
of opportunities to connect with other travelers and form new friendships that
could last a lifetime.
